Hola:
Tengo un menu horinzontal con un submenu desplegable, que funciona bien en IE, pero en Firefox no. En Firefox cuando uno pasa el mouse sobre los diferentes botones, el submenu queda como colgado y no va cambiando en los diferentes submenus, cosa que si realiza el IE. Espero se entienda mi inquietud. Les dejo el CSS. Gracias. Vanina
Codigo:
<div id="menu"><span class="menu">
<ul>
<li><a href="index.php">| Quiénes somos? |</a></li>
<li><a href="#.php">Servicios |</a>
<ul>
<li><a href="prevencion.php">Prevención ·</a></li>
<li><a href="asistencia.php">Asistencia ·</a></li>
<li><a href="docencia.php">Docencia</a></li>
</ul>
</li>
<li><a href="#">Modalidades de Tratamiento |</a>
<ul>
<li><a href="tratamiento.php">Tratamiento Ambulatorio ·</a></li>
<li><a href="tratamiento.php#1">Hospital de Día ·</a></li>
<li><a href="tratamiento.php#2">Centro de Noche ·</a></li>
<li><a href="tratamiento.php#3">Programa Residencial ·</a></li>
<li><a href="tratamiento.php#4">Tratamiento Familiar</a></li>
</ul>
</li>
<li><a href="staff.php">Staff |</a></li>
<li><a href="#">Galería de Imágenes |</a>
<ul>
<li><a href="galeria_alh2.php"><span class="menu">.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. </span>La Alhambrita Quilmes ·</a></li>
<li><a href="galeria_alh1.php">· La Alhambrita Berazategui</a></li>
</ul>
</li>
<li><a href="#">Cómo llegar? |</a>
<ul>
<li><a href="mapa_alh2.php"><span class="menu">.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. </span>La Alhambrita Quilmes ·</a></li>
<li><a href="mapa_alh1.php">· La Alhambrita Berazategui</a></li>
</ul>
</li>
<li><a href="contacto.php">Contacto |</a></li>
</ul>
</span>
</div>
/* Css Menu */
#menu { font-family:Verdana, sans-serif; clear:both; width: 899px; height:55px; background:url(../imagenes/fondo_menu2.jpg) no-repeat; padding-left: 40px; padding-top: 5px}
#menu ul {clear:both; height:20px; margin: 0; padding: 0; list-style: none; line-height:normal; font-weight: bold}
#menu li {display: inline; list-style: none; float: left; width: auto;}
#menu a { display: inline; float: left; margin: 0; padding: 10px 5px; font-size: 12px; font-weight: 100; color:#009900; font-weight: bold; text-decoration: none; width: auto; }
#menu li a { display: inline; text-decoration: none; }
#menu li li a { font-size:11px; letter-spacing:0px; }
#menu a:hover { color: #000000; font-weight:bold; }
#menu li ul { display: none; }
#menu li:hover ul, #menu li.hover ul {
position: absolute;
display: inline;
left: 0;
width: 75%; margin-left:110px;
padding: 35px; }
#menu li:hover li, #menu li.hover li {
float: left; width:auto }
#menu li:hover li a, #menu li.hover li a {
color: #000 }
#menu li li a:hover {
color: #009900; }
.menu { width:auto; color:#CCCCCC}